基于Java的动漫App开发可以使用Android Studio集成开发环境和Java编程语言进行开发。开发者可以使用Android开发工具包(Android SDK)提供的各种API和开发工具,构建出适用于Android系统的动漫App。在开发中可以使用Java语言编写业务逻辑、控制App的流程以及实现各种功能。同时,开发者需要熟悉Android系统的特性和限制,以便更好地进行App的设计和开发
转载
2023-06-25 15:01:18
242阅读
今天为大家继续分享泡泡堂小游戏的开发与制作 409,目前系统已经完成了初步功能,后续会进一步完善。整个系统界面漂亮,有完整得源码,希望大家可以喜欢。开发环境 开发语言为Java,开发环境Eclipse或者IDEA都可以。运行主程序,或者执行打开JAR文件即可以运行本程序。 系统框架 利用JDK自带的SWING框架开
转载
2023-11-22 15:11:29
84阅读
# 用Java做UI
在软件开发中,用户界面(UI)是用户与程序交互的重要部分。而Java作为一种流行的编程语言,也提供了丰富的工具和库来实现各种UI设计。本文将介绍如何使用Java来创建用户界面,并提供一些代码示例帮助读者快速上手。
## Java GUI框架
Java提供了多种方式来构建用户界面,其中最常用的是基于Swing和JavaFX的GUI框架。Swing是Java自带的GUI工具
原创
2024-05-02 06:39:25
48阅读
此代码实现了显示/新建/修改删除/退出的功能import java.util.Scanner;/*~实现步骤:1.新建容器/学生数组/一维数组: 姓名 年龄 性别 班级 院系 成绩2.在静态代码块中进行初始化操作,存入默认的三个学生信息3.在start方法中,搭建系统界面4.实现 显示学生信息的界面==>showStudent()==>getAllStudent();==&
转载
2023-06-16 14:32:05
0阅读
# 用Java做魔塔:探索编程与游戏的结合
魔塔是一款经典的角色扮演类游戏,玩家需要在一个充满敌人和挑战的塔楼中逐层前进。每层有不同的敌人、道具和谜题。游戏的目标是消灭塔楼中的魔王。通过编写一个简单的魔塔游戏,我们不仅能够感受到编程的乐趣,也可以深刻理解游戏设计的基本元素。
## 设计思路
在设计魔塔游戏时,我们需要考虑以下几个方面:
1. **角色**:玩家和敌人都有各自的属性,如生命值
java基础类型篇在java中switch作用类型在java中,只能作用int基本类型,因为short,char,byte都可以隐士转换为int类型,所以这些以及这些类型的包装类型也是可以的,但是long,string不能被隐士转换为int类型,所以他们不能被作用于switch语句中Char型变量中能不能存储一个中文汉字Char型变量用来存储unicode编码字符的,unicode编码字符集中包含
转载
2024-03-14 10:06:25
206阅读
近年来,纯java的类excel报表工具异军突起,在国内报表工具市场中取得了初步成功。目前市场上主流的纯java类excel的报表工具有润乾、杰表4.0、finereport等。类excel报表工具之所以受国人追捧,一方面是契合了国内用户喜欢用格子做报表的习惯,另一方面,由于扩展的类excel报表模型的推出,比如润乾的非线性多源分片模型,杰表4.0的超级cell模型,满足了用户编制复杂报表的需求。
转载
2023-09-20 16:27:55
80阅读
一、简介这个打包程序主要包含了对Java程序的普通打包、对程序的管理员权限设置。因为自己打包的时候要求程序在32位操作系统和64位操作系统下都能使用,所以有些打包步骤和设置都不相同。打包过程中主要使用到的软件有exe4j、Inno Setup;修改用户权限时使用到了eXeScope.exe和ResHacker.exe。二、具体打包步骤1.准备好要打包的完整程序。在这个程序中包含着JRE,打包后的程
转载
2023-10-12 22:15:12
145阅读
# Java中的指针与循环
### 引言
在许多编程语言中,指针是一个关键的概念,允许开发者直接操纵内存。然而,Java语言的设计哲学选择了避免显式指针操作,转而使用引用。这意味着,Java语言中的变量实际上是对对象的引用,而不是直接的内存地址。尽管如此,Java依然可以实现指针类似的行为,通过引用操作循环以达到目的。本文将通过代码示例探讨Java中的引用和循环的操作,并绘制类图和关系图来进一
# 用Java做登录
## 引言
登录是现代应用程序中常见的功能之一。无论是网站、移动应用还是桌面应用,登录都是用户与应用进行交互的第一步。本文将介绍使用Java编写登录功能的方法,并提供相应的代码示例。
## 登录功能的实现
登录功能的实现涉及到用户输入验证、数据库查询和密码加密等方面的知识。下面将逐步介绍每个步骤的具体实现。
### 用户输入验证
在用户输入验证中,我们需要验证用户
原创
2023-08-04 07:32:12
62阅读
# 使用Java实现电子签章
随着数字化进程的加速,电子签章在各个行业中的应用越来越广泛。它不仅提高了工作效率,而且大大降低了纸质文件的使用。本文将介绍如何使用Java实现电子签章,并通过代码示例来帮助大家理解其基本原理和实现方式。
## 什么是电子签章?
电子签章是一种用电子方式实现的一种签名,具有法律效力。它可用于身份认证、数据完整性验证等场景。简单来说,电子签章可以用来取代传统的手写签
原创
2024-10-14 05:00:06
139阅读
## 如何利用Java制作桌面应用
作为一名经验丰富的开发者,我将帮助你学习如何使用Java来制作桌面应用。首先,让我们来看看整个流程的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 创建一个新的Java项目 |
| 2 | 设计用户界面 |
| 3 | 编写业务逻辑 |
| 4 | 编译和运行应用 |
接下来,让我为你详细解释每个步骤需要做什么,并给出相应的代码
原创
2024-04-28 06:43:56
23阅读
# 用Vim做Java开发:一个轻量级的选择
在现代软件开发中,IDE(集成开发环境)是无处不在的工具。虽然大多数开发者习惯于使用像Eclipse、IntelliJ IDEA这样的全面IDE,但Vim作为一个轻量级的文本编辑器,凭借其快速和可定制性,已经受到许多开发者的青睐。在这篇文章中,我们将探讨如何使用Vim进行Java开发,并提供一些实用的代码示例。
## Vim环境配置
首先,确保你
原创
2024-09-13 04:12:01
66阅读
# 用Java开发PLM系统的基础知识
产品生命周期管理(Product Lifecycle Management,简称PLM)是指在产品的整个生命周期内,从产品的最初构思和设计阶段到生产、销售及退市阶段,对产品信息进行全方位管理的系统。PLM系统的主要目的是提高企业运营效率、降低成本、提高产品质量。在本篇文章中,我们将探讨如何使用Java语言来构建一个简单的PLM系统。
## PLM系统的基
# 用Java做动效教程
## 引言
作为一名经验丰富的开发者,我将指导你如何使用Java实现动效。这篇文章将以步骤形式展示整个过程,并提供每一步所需的代码示例和注释。
## 流程概述
首先,让我们了解整个实现动效的流程。以下是一些步骤的简要表格:
| 步骤 | 描述 |
|------|----------------------|
| 1 | 创建
原创
2024-04-23 05:12:26
62阅读
# 用Java做麻将游戏
麻将是一种古老且流行的亚洲桌面游戏,它需要四个玩家使用一副有136张牌的牌组来进行。每位玩家需要根据特定的规则和策略来组合自己的牌,以达到胡牌的目标。在本文中,我们将介绍如何使用Java编写一个简单的麻将游戏。
## 游戏规则
麻将的规则非常复杂,每个地区的玩法都可能有所不同。在我们的示例中,我们将使用中国广东的麻将规则。
1. 开始游戏时,每个玩家会从牌堆中抓取
原创
2024-02-16 08:49:53
547阅读
# 使用Map实现枚举
在Java中,枚举是一种常见的数据类型,用于定义一组固定的常量。通常情况下,我们会使用enum关键字来定义枚举类型。不过,有时候我们可能需要更灵活的方式来实现枚举,这时可以考虑使用Map来实现。
## 为什么使用Map实现枚举
使用Map来实现枚举有以下几个优点:
1. 可以动态添加、删除常量,而不需要修改代码;
2. 可以实现更复杂的逻辑,比如根据不同的条件返回不同
原创
2024-06-15 06:10:40
43阅读
## Java中使用函数作为参数
在Java中,函数也可以作为参数传递给其他函数,这种特性称为高阶函数。通过将函数作为参数传递,我们可以更加灵活地编写代码,实现更加功能强大的程序。
### 为什么要使用函数作为参数
使用函数作为参数可以让我们在调用函数时动态地传递不同的功能。这种方式可以减少代码的重复性,提高代码的复用性,同时也能更容易实现一些复杂的逻辑。
### 示例代码
让我们通过一
原创
2024-05-25 05:01:25
21阅读
# 使用Java开发记账软件:从入门到实践
如今,记账软件在个人理财和小企业管理中扮演着重要角色。然而,了解如何从零开始开发一个简单的记账软件却并不容易。本文将通过具体的Java代码示例带您认识记账软件的基本构建方法。
## 1. 记账软件的基本需求
在开始编写代码之前,我们需要明确我们的记账软件应该具备哪些基本功能:
- 添加收入和支出
- 查看账目记录
- 生成收支汇总
## 2.
原创
2024-09-27 07:55:26
166阅读
## Java使用Map做缓存的实现
### 1. 缓存的概念
在软件开发中,缓存是一种提高系统性能和响应速度的常用策略。缓存可以存储经常被访问的数据,当系统需要这些数据时,可以直接从缓存中获取,而不需要再次去访问磁盘或者网络。在Java中,我们可以使用Map数据结构来实现缓存功能。
### 2. 实现步骤
下面是使用Map实现缓存的一般步骤:
| 步骤 | 描述 |
| --- | --
原创
2023-08-01 07:40:46
1007阅读